(August 2023) Episode 515 is GEORGE GERSHWIN. If America had a soundtrack, Gershwin’s “Rhapsody in Blue” and “Porgy and Bess” would surely be on it. He bridged classical and popular music, creating audience favorites played from living rooms to Broadway, movies and concert halls. The music is indelibly evocative of the Art Deco and the Jazz Age.
